Supporting close
to 237 herbivores per km2,
the Maasai Mara ecosystem has the richest assemblages of
wildlife in the world, making it one of the most productive
natural terrestrial ecosystems.
It is not only the numbers but the species composition
that is buffling. The
Mara highlight is the annual wildlife migration (JUL/AUG/SEP),
when over a million wildebeest accompanied by Zebras, Thomson�s
gazelles, in close vicinity of the predators migrate from
Serengeti to Mara and back.
Day 7 - 8. Masai
Mara
Masai Mara National
Reserve is the northern extension of Tanzania's famous Serengeti
Plains. It is Kenya's premier place of seeing wildlife, and home
to a thriving population of predators such as lion and cheetah,
as well as hippo, crocodile, zebra, giraffe, elephant,
wildebeest and impala. Today, enjoy thrilling morning and
afternoon game-viewing drives in this photographer's paradise.
